Mountain Hardwear launches The Mountain ACademy

launch the 1st edition of The Mountain ACademy

The Mountain ACademy is your opportunity to be part of the next step of mountaineering and alpinism.
Because Mountaineering is an inexhaustible source of inspiration for young enthusiasts!
Because Mountaineering is not confined to exploits, extreme and competition!
Because before all, Mountaineering is related to human relationships, unexpected meetings, privileged sceneries, images, stories, feelings, respect and freedom.

More than sweat, competition, and pain, The Mountain ACademy focuses on words such as harmony, pleasure, respect, sensation, feeling, and commitment. The Mountain ACademy wants to illustrate the "freeride" face of mountaineering.


WHAT?
From June 2007 to 20th November, mountaineering enthusiasts (non-professional), men & women, under 33 years old, will have the opportunity to apply to be part of the 1st Mountain ACademy run by Mountain Hardwear in collaboration with Black Diamond & Vertical Magazine,
From December 2007 to June 2009, the selected participants of the 1st Mountain ACademy will be
- guided by mountain professional, athletes, personalities...
- equipped & supported by Mountain Hardwear & Black Diamond
- covered by Vertical Magazine, the 1st european mountaineering magazine
- gathered into 5 base camps located in the Alps, Pre Alps... from 5 to 10 days
- encouraged and helped to build contents (photos, videos, reports...)
- supported to gain experiences & media coverage
- part of a multi cultural young team
- part of a human & passionate adventure

WHO CAN APPLY?
Young mountaineers, climber enthusiasts selected according to their sportive abilities and motivations;
After selections, 8 of them will be chosen.
- Men & Women,
- European citizen and/or part of Europe continent (geographical limits, from North of Russia to South of Spain, from Atlantic ocean to Oural mountains).
- European residents too. All nationalities are accepted if the applicants lives in Europe continent (as defined before).
- Maximum: 33 years old
- Minimum: legal majority in regards of the national Law of each applicant (18 years old in France, Austria, Germany, Ireland, Italy... for example)
- Mountaineering abilities will be selective. Applicants should have advanced skills in all activities related to mountaineering. An evaluation profile and a list of main achievements is asked (see the list of document to download and fill in)
- Abilities to understand, speak, read and write English language is necessary. We are not asking for absolute "fluent" level but most of the communications will be done in English, so...
- No exclusive sponsoring contract with clothing, equipment & material mountaineering brand


PLANNING
June 2007 – 20th November : Applications period
20th November – 30th November : selection of the 8 candidates
13-15th December: Technical controls with all selected candidates
January 2008: 1st base camp located in Hautes Alpes (France) – 5 days / Ice climbing
May 2008: 2nd base camp located in Valle d’Aosta (Italia) – 5 days / mountaineering
September 2008: 3rd base camp located in… secret spot – 5 days / Adventure Climbing
December 2008: Personal or collective project
June 2009: Final base camp located in… Mont-Blanc Massif – 10 days / Mix & Festival
